Investigation shows no hazardous materials at Rosemont hotel

A reported hazmat situation at a Rosemont hotel Thursday afternoon turned out to be not so hazardous after all.

The situation began about 4:30 Thursday with a small fire in a room at the Hampton Inn on the 9400 block of West Higgins Road. Investigators discovered suspicious materials in the room after the fire was extinguished. They took two suspects into custody and evacuated the hotel. The fire department even hosed down some of the guests.

On Friday, police said they have not yet determined what the materials are, but Illinois State Police have ruled out anything of a hazardous nature. Guests and emergency response personnel were hosed down in accordance with standard decontamination procedures associated with every potential hazmat situation, police said.

The one hotel guest was taken to a hospital at the guest's request. There was no update on that guest's condition available Friday.

The two suspects involved were released without charges, pending further investigation.
